- EPC Contractor - Power Plants
- SPP/ IPP Developer for power generation projects
Engineering, supply, installation & commissioning
- Hospital Equipment - Laboratory Equipment
United National Global Compact: Communication on Progress 3 October 2020 to 3 October 2021
<< Back to Knowledge Sharing